Output 85ecedcdbebd6c03e06c5a5aa4ed8c4d51d3500ff5eae3bc64dee50cf83cb0af:1

value
166511
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e87ade964038f46273e2c11ddfe0f61a7e08458e OP_EQUALVERIFY OP_CHECKSIG
address
1NCExdJCpAog51Twjx7BpTqGYqW67G3BMM
transaction
85ecedcdbebd6c03e06c5a5aa4ed8c4d51d3500ff5eae3bc64dee50cf83cb0af
confirmations
143936
spent
true